What is the purpose of a scupper on a roof?
The primary purpose of a scupper on a roof is to drain rainwater away from the roof surface. They act as outlets, typically located along the edge of a flat roof or parapet wall, allowing water to flow directly from the roof to a gutter, downspout, or other drainage system. This prevents water from pooling on the roof, which can lead to leaks, damage to roofing materials, and structural issues.
What are roof scuppers made of?
Scuppers can be constructed from a variety of materials, each with its own advantages and disadvantages. Common materials include:
-
Metal: Copper, galvanized steel, aluminum, and stainless steel are popular choices due to their durability and resistance to corrosion. Metal scuppers are often chosen for their longevity and ability to withstand harsh weather conditions.
-
PVC: Polyvinyl chloride (PVC) is a cost-effective option that's lightweight and easy to install. However, PVC scuppers may not be as durable as metal ones, especially in extreme climates.
-
Concrete: Concrete scuppers are often used in large-scale projects or industrial buildings. They're sturdy and durable, but can be more expensive and difficult to install than other materials.
The choice of material often depends on the overall design of the building, budget constraints, and the specific climatic conditions.
How do scuppers differ from gutters?
While both scuppers and gutters are involved in roof drainage, they differ significantly in their placement and function:
-
Scuppers are typically integrated into the roofline itself, often appearing as openings or slots along the edge. They handle the primary drainage, often directing large volumes of water.
-
Gutters are external channels that run along the roof's edge, collecting water that flows down the roof's slope. Gutters rely on gravity to move water to downspouts.
Essentially, scuppers serve as a primary drainage point, often working in conjunction with gutters to ensure efficient water removal from the roof.
How are scuppers installed on a roof?
Scupper installation is a specialized task best left to experienced roofing professionals. The process generally involves:
-
Planning and design: Determining the optimal location and number of scuppers based on roof size, slope, and drainage requirements.
-
Cutting openings: Carefully creating openings in the roof deck to accommodate the scuppers.
-
Flashing: Installing flashing around the scuppers to create a watertight seal, preventing leaks.
-
Secure attachment: Attaching the scuppers securely to the roof deck, ensuring proper alignment and drainage.
-
Connection to downspouts or drains: Connecting the scuppers to a suitable drainage system to efficiently remove water from the building.
What are the common problems with roof scuppers?
Like any part of a roof drainage system, scuppers can experience issues over time. Common problems include:
-
Clogging: Debris such as leaves, twigs, and other materials can block scuppers, reducing their effectiveness and potentially leading to water backup.
-
Corrosion: Metal scuppers can corrode over time, especially in harsh environments, compromising their structural integrity and leading to leaks.
-
Leaks: Improper installation or damage to flashing around the scuppers can result in leaks.
Regular inspection and maintenance are crucial to prevent these problems and ensure the longevity of your roof scuppers.
How often should roof scuppers be inspected?
Regular inspection of roof scuppers is essential for preventing problems. Ideally, you should inspect them at least twice a year, once in the spring and once in the fall. During these inspections, check for clogs, corrosion, damage, and proper drainage. For buildings in areas with heavy rainfall or significant debris accumulation, more frequent inspections might be necessary.
